>>>>> "jack-monotone" == jack-monotone  <address@hidden> writes:

    jack-monotone> - support of symlinks

Just curious, why do you want to support symlinks?

Maybe it would be better without? Consider the possibility of checking
out the source code to some project and editing a file, without
realizing somebody (either accidently or maliciously) replaced it with
a symlink to something under /etc.

Or maybe this is something that could be decided using policy
branches?
